Establishing a Bankroll Management Plan
A key strategy in risk management is effective bankroll management. Establishing a clear budget for gambling activities ensures that players only wager what they can afford to lose. This means setting aside a specific amount of money dedicated solely to gambling and adhering strictly to that limit. By doing so, players can enjoy the thrill of gambling without the stress of financial strain.
Additionally, it’s advisable to divide your bankroll into smaller portions for individual gaming sessions. This tactic not only prolongs the gaming experience but also helps maintain control over spending. By sticking to predetermined limits for each session, players are less likely to chase losses or make impulsive bets, leading to more responsible gambling behavior.
Utilizing Game Selection to Mitigate Risk
Choosing the right games is another critical component of risk management in gambling. Some games offer better odds and lower house edges, thereby reducing the overall risk. For instance, table games like blackjack and baccarat often provide more favorable conditions for skilled players than many slot machines. Understanding the nuances of different games can empower players to select options that align with their risk management strategies.
In addition to the odds, players should consider their own skill level when selecting games. Engaging in games that require a level of expertise can enhance both enjoyment and potential profitability. By aligning game selection with personal skills and knowledge, players can effectively manage their risk while increasing their chances for success.
Implementing Psychological Strategies for Better Decision-Making
The psychological aspect of gambling plays a significant role in risk management. Emotional responses, such as excitement or frustration, can lead to irrational decision-making. To counteract this, players should develop strategies that promote rational thinking during play. Techniques such as mindfulness can help maintain focus and clarity, allowing for more calculated decisions.
Moreover, setting time limits on gambling sessions can help mitigate emotional swings. Taking regular breaks not only allows players to reset but also provides an opportunity to reflect on their strategies and outcomes. This structured approach to gambling helps maintain a healthy perspective and encourages responsible behavior throughout the gaming experience.
